Album Review

Combining grungy guitar riffs with drum'n'bass beats, Questamation is the Pendulum-esque debut album from Toronto duo Ash Buchholz and Jason Parsons, aka Ubiquitous Synergy Seeker. Produced by Matthew Von Wagner (Crystal Castles), the 2009 follow-up to their Welding the C:/ EP was released through their own independent label, Smashing World Records, and includes the single "Laces Out." ~ Jon O'Brien, Rovi

Fantastic Album...

Having been hooked by Hollow Point and Porntostartrek from Welding the C:\ I picked up Questamation without hesitation, I'd already purchased the Laces out single so I knew there was one wicked track already, and I'm happy to report that the rest of the album does not dissapoint. I've been listening to the album for a few days now and I've become very attached to Cloudboy, Neurochemical Warfare, Anti-Venom, and my current favourite, Visionary Science Patrol. It's a strong album from start to finish, great pace and fun lyrics. Thanks U.S.S!!

Better than most, not better than them.

Questamation, in my opinion, is better than most records that could be put out by bands of today, however i personally believe it lacks slightly in comparason to Welding the C:/. The lyrics are different this time around, and tend to flow, and make sense, a new trend i'm not sure i am happy with. Instrumentation is brilliant. Overall, takes a few listens, but a sure buy for anyone
